recommended_documentation ISO 10303-239 Representation

The business objects introduced in the Business Information Overview section are modelled in PLCS through a set of business templates. Most business templates are based upon one or more generic PLCS templates. They may be specializations of a PLCS template using one or more classifications or characterizations to capture the required information, whilst some rename and use restricted parameters.

This section summarizes the mappings of the business objects to the corresponding templates. A diagrammatic representation of the AP239 templates used is shown below in Figure 2.

NOTE    To improve understanding of the diagram, not all of the templates referenced in the table are shown.

Business Object

Business Object Definition

Business Templates

Assumption This information object represents the required infromation for an assumption about a required precondition used as a basis for decision.that has been made by a person. UK_Defence.assumption
Constraint This template describes how to represent a requirement that sets specific limits that must be complied with. UK_Defence.constraint
Document This information object represents reference material that follows a formal change approval mechanism. UK_Defence.document
Hardcopy Document This information object represents a document that is in hardcopy form. UK_Defence.hardcopy_document
Electronic Document This information object represents a document that is in electronic form. UK_Defence.electronic_document
Document Relationship This information object represents the relationship between two documents. For example, this could be used to state that one document has been or will be, produced using a standard or specification defined by the other document in the relationship. UK_Defence.related_documents
Facility This information object describes how to represent an installation providing one or more functional capabilities necessary to provide support to one or more equipment programmes. UK_Defence.facility
Location This information object defines a location. UK_Defence.location
Message This information object represents a communicated statement of events, activities, or outcomes that have taken place. UK_Defence.message
Person This information object represents the information describing a human being. This represents the information describing a human being. UK_Defence.person
Organization This information object represents an organized body, project, programme or society, which may or may not be a legal entity. UK_Defence.organization
Property The property business object is used by those TLSS Data Exchange Specifications that require information about a functional or physical aspect of the information object that it is a property of. UK_Defence.property
Recommended Documentation This information object identifies the recommended documentation required, over a defined period of time, to support the Platform, system and equipment for which the associated Support Solution Definition was developed. UK_Defence.recommended_documentation
Recommended Document This information object identifies the recommended documnt and the quantities required at a particular location. UK_Defence.recommended_document
Support Solution Definition This information object represents the results of analysing the support need for the related platform, system and equipment, in terms of the planned tasks that are required to support it through life. UK_Defence.support_solution_definition
Status Assignment This information object represents the record of the assignment of a status to a subject. UK_Defence.status_assignment

Table 2 — Business Objects to Template Mapping table
